Output 305070431b0804de8596a657b29cd05dee9ce82d138fa1413be99a7d50a8aa45:0

value
149107
script pubkey
OP_0 OP_PUSHBYTES_20 df4a5c2d57d145b4e7e4bed3899f951e88c695e6
address
bc1qma99ct2h69zmfelyhmfcn8u4r6yvd90xhtj7c0
transaction
305070431b0804de8596a657b29cd05dee9ce82d138fa1413be99a7d50a8aa45
spent
true